Here’s a concise update on Hao-Yu Lee.
Latest news overview
- Hao-Yu Lee returned from an oblique injury and was reinstated from the injured list in early April 2026, starting a rehab path that included a stint in the minor leagues before rejoining Triple-A Toledo. This marks his continued progression toward MLB opportunities as the Tigers push him through the system. [Source: RotoWire reporting on Lee’s IL return and rehab progression, April 2026][1]
